Création en code d'un état d'une requête analyse croisée
2 réponses
dakota77
Bonjour,
Je voudrais r=E9aliser en code une mise en page correcte=20
d'une requ=EAte analyse crois=E9e.=20
1) Y aurait-il un exemple de code pour r=E9aliser ce genre=20
d'=E9tat ?
2) Il faut en code cr=E9er chaque ent=EAte de colonne. Comment=20
est-il possible de r=E9cup=E9rer les ent=EAtes de colonnes de la=20
requ=EAte crois=E9e ? Pour, par la suite, les cr=E9er dans=20
l'=E9tat ?
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
Gilbert
Bonjour,
Pour récupérer les entête des colonnes:
Set rst = CurrentDb.OpenRecordset(TaRequete) For i = 1 To rst.Fields.Count 'Nombre de champs 'Nom du champ et Type du champ et Taille du champ MsgBox rst.Fields(i).Name & " " & rst.Fields(i).Type & " " & rst.Fields(i).Size Next i
Cordialement
Gilbert
"dakota77" a écrit dans le message de news: 00e701c3c794$8034ff70$ Bonjour,
Je voudrais réaliser en code une mise en page correcte d'une requête analyse croisée. 1) Y aurait-il un exemple de code pour réaliser ce genre d'état ?
2) Il faut en code créer chaque entête de colonne. Comment est-il possible de récupérer les entêtes de colonnes de la requête croisée ? Pour, par la suite, les créer dans l'état ?
Merci pour votre aide. Mario
Bonjour,
Pour récupérer les entête des colonnes:
Set rst = CurrentDb.OpenRecordset(TaRequete)
For i = 1 To rst.Fields.Count 'Nombre de champs
'Nom du champ et Type du champ et Taille du champ
MsgBox rst.Fields(i).Name & " " & rst.Fields(i).Type & " " &
rst.Fields(i).Size
Next i
Cordialement
Gilbert
"dakota77" <anonymous@discussions.microsoft.com> a écrit dans le message de
news: 00e701c3c794$8034ff70$a001280a@phx.gbl...
Bonjour,
Je voudrais réaliser en code une mise en page correcte
d'une requête analyse croisée.
1) Y aurait-il un exemple de code pour réaliser ce genre
d'état ?
2) Il faut en code créer chaque entête de colonne. Comment
est-il possible de récupérer les entêtes de colonnes de la
requête croisée ? Pour, par la suite, les créer dans
l'état ?
Set rst = CurrentDb.OpenRecordset(TaRequete) For i = 1 To rst.Fields.Count 'Nombre de champs 'Nom du champ et Type du champ et Taille du champ MsgBox rst.Fields(i).Name & " " & rst.Fields(i).Type & " " & rst.Fields(i).Size Next i
Cordialement
Gilbert
"dakota77" a écrit dans le message de news: 00e701c3c794$8034ff70$ Bonjour,
Je voudrais réaliser en code une mise en page correcte d'une requête analyse croisée. 1) Y aurait-il un exemple de code pour réaliser ce genre d'état ?
2) Il faut en code créer chaque entête de colonne. Comment est-il possible de récupérer les entêtes de colonnes de la requête croisée ? Pour, par la suite, les créer dans l'état ?
Merci pour votre aide. Mario
Dakota77
Génial. Un grand merci Gilbert.
-----Message d'origine----- Bonjour,
Pour récupérer les entête des colonnes:
Set rst = CurrentDb.OpenRecordset(TaRequete) For i = 1 To rst.Fields.Count 'Nombre de champs 'Nom du champ et Type du champ et Taille du champ MsgBox rst.Fields(i).Name & " " & rst.Fields (i).Type & " " &
rst.Fields(i).Size Next i
Cordialement
Gilbert
"dakota77" a écrit dans le message de
news: 00e701c3c794$8034ff70$ Bonjour,
Je voudrais réaliser en code une mise en page correcte d'une requête analyse croisée. 1) Y aurait-il un exemple de code pour réaliser ce genre d'état ?
2) Il faut en code créer chaque entête de colonne. Comment est-il possible de récupérer les entêtes de colonnes de la requête croisée ? Pour, par la suite, les créer dans l'état ?
Merci pour votre aide. Mario
.
Génial. Un grand merci Gilbert.
-----Message d'origine-----
Bonjour,
Pour récupérer les entête des colonnes:
Set rst = CurrentDb.OpenRecordset(TaRequete)
For i = 1 To rst.Fields.Count 'Nombre de champs
'Nom du champ et Type du champ et Taille du champ
MsgBox rst.Fields(i).Name & " " & rst.Fields
(i).Type & " " &
rst.Fields(i).Size
Next i
Cordialement
Gilbert
"dakota77" <anonymous@discussions.microsoft.com> a écrit
dans le message de
Je voudrais réaliser en code une mise en page correcte
d'une requête analyse croisée.
1) Y aurait-il un exemple de code pour réaliser ce genre
d'état ?
2) Il faut en code créer chaque entête de colonne. Comment
est-il possible de récupérer les entêtes de colonnes de la
requête croisée ? Pour, par la suite, les créer dans
l'état ?
Set rst = CurrentDb.OpenRecordset(TaRequete) For i = 1 To rst.Fields.Count 'Nombre de champs 'Nom du champ et Type du champ et Taille du champ MsgBox rst.Fields(i).Name & " " & rst.Fields (i).Type & " " &
rst.Fields(i).Size Next i
Cordialement
Gilbert
"dakota77" a écrit dans le message de
news: 00e701c3c794$8034ff70$ Bonjour,
Je voudrais réaliser en code une mise en page correcte d'une requête analyse croisée. 1) Y aurait-il un exemple de code pour réaliser ce genre d'état ?
2) Il faut en code créer chaque entête de colonne. Comment est-il possible de récupérer les entêtes de colonnes de la requête croisée ? Pour, par la suite, les créer dans l'état ?